Thanks for the feedback about the docks you have used.
What I ended up getting is an "Inateck UA2001 USB 3.0 IDE + SATA
Converter" at Amazon for $29 + $8 SH because it looked fine and I got
tired of looking... It's one of those simple "lay everything on the
desk" multi plug jobs. It comes with 3 wires:
- an AC power adapter
- a USB cord to computer
- and a short power wire from device to IDE power plug.
It has a power switch to turn all on/off.
I'm using F19 and LXDE.
I started with the IDE drive, all plugs in place and turned on power.
The removable drive dialog opened and asked if I wanted to use the file
manager. So I can use that or a terminal with no problems.
And just like flash drives it shows up in /run/media/user/xxxxxx.
So after doing some housecleaning on that drive I hot plugged a big SATA
drive in and it cranked up and another 2 dialogs opened, one for each
partition on the drive.
I could plug another 2 1/2" SATA drive into it too if I wanted.
I copied 1.9g from the IDE to my laptop in about 2 minutes.
